Job Description

Be a Star at Straz Center for the Performing Arts! Straz Center is seeking a dynamic and experienced professional to join our leadership team as Vice President of Administration. This role supports the Chief Administrative and Finance Office (CAFO) and President /CEO to obtain the organization's short and long-term business objectives, acting as second in charge as needed for CAFO responsibility areas. This position oversees the daily administrative, finance, human resource (HR) and information technology (IT) functions in providing tactical leadership and management in working with external Legal Counsel and administrative business partners. Located in downtown Tampa, the 335,000 square-foot Straz Center, one of the largest performing arts complexes in the country, offers a team-based work environment that shows our dedication to the community every day. We reward our full-time employees with a strong benefits package including options for health/dental, vision, etc., discounted downtown parking, food and show discounts, plus a generous 403(b) plan and up to 27 days of PTO/Holidays per year. Essential Functions: Leadership Assist with organizational administrative, financial, human resource and system functions, strategies, and efficiency projects Training and evaluating subordinate staff, as appropriate Assist in developing and monitoring the organization's fiscal, audit and compliance, investment, compensation and benefit and governance policies Assist with overall legal and risk management Support the CAFO in coordination of Strategic Planning, Budgeting and Forecasting Oversight of contract administration Assist with annual reviews of the multi-year strategic plan Treasury / Fiduciary Fiduciary, investment, financing, and risk management analysis and decisions Investment policies and actions Preparing cash flow projection reporting and analysis Serve as key point of contact with banks and financial institutions Accounting, Reporting, Audit, Tax and Compliance Accurate preparation, reporting, and ongoing analysis of all internal and external financial statements, payroll compensation, revenue, departmental expenses, profit centers, and related taxes Compliance with federal, state, and local legal and tax requirements Review management recommendations relating to financial condition, annual operating and capital budgets, and strategic initiatives Selection of external auditors and tax firm, internal controls, and compliance activities IT Oversight of the IT function, ensuring that the organization's technology infrastructure, systems, processes, communication, staff training, cyber security, and disaster recovery initiatives are implemented, monitored, and maintained as needed HR Management and oversight of the HR team relating to HR Policy and Procedure, Legal and Regulatory Compliance, Recruitment and Staffing, Payroll, 403(b) Administration, Employee Benefits, Compensation, Performance Management, Diversity and Inclusion, Succession Planning, Training and Professional Development, and Employee Relations. Serves as a staff liaison for Straz Center Board Human Resources Committee. Supervisory Responsibilities: Manage and lead Finance, HR, and IT staff teams. Serve as back up to the CAFO, as necessary, in supporting departmental executives. Other: Other duties as assigned Minimum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ities): Demonstrated success in leading HR functions and IT teams Strong expertise in IT management and strategy Strong financial acumen and experience with complex budgets Excellent interpersonal, organizational, leadership, management and listening skills are required Ability to attract, retain, train, develop and appraise staff effectively Proficiency in computer desk top knowledge; intermediate to advanced knowledge of Microsoft Office Familiarity with accounting and spreadsheet applications is required Apply general working knowledge of integrated business system applications Have commitment to accuracy and detail Education and Work Experience: A bachelor's degree in accounting, Finance, Business Administration, HR, IT, or other related field of study required Minimum 10 years of experience in staff management and senior leadership roles with a focus on Administration, Finance, HR, and IT, including a previous Controllership or Financial Director position Minimum 3-5 years of general HR and IT business/systems/project management Non-profit financial and business management experience is a plus Certifications / Licenses: CPA certification and/or MBA degree (or equivalent) required CMA certification is acceptable in lieu of MBA HR (e.g., SHRM) and IT certifications are a plus Physical Demands: The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the functions of this job.
